Product information

Description

Supermicro MBD-X11SDV-8C-TP8F-B is a Flex-ATX server motherboard built around an integrated Intel SoC featuring the Intel® Xeon® D-2146NT processor. The board supports up to 512 GB of DDR4 memory across four DIMM slots, provides SATA III storage with hardware RAID levels 0, 1, 5 and 10, and includes onboard Aspeed AST2500 out-of-band graphics for remote management. Dual Gigabit Ethernet interfaces and a compact Flex-ATX form factor make this motherboard suitable for space-constrained server installations, storage nodes and network appliances that require server-grade CPU performance and high memory capacity.

Advantages

This Supermicro motherboard integrates a Xeon D SoC to deliver multi-core server performance with lower power consumption compared with separate CPU and chipset solutions. The support for up to 512 GB of DDR4 RAM across four DIMM slots enables large memory footprints for virtualization or in-memory databases. Built-in SATA III ports with RAID 0/1/5/10 simplify local storage configurations, while the Aspeed AST2500 controller offers remote management and basic video output without an additional GPU. The Flex-ATX form factor allows installation in compact chassis where a full-size server board would not fit.

Key specifications

  • Processor: integrated Intel® Xeon® D-2146NT SoC with multiple cores
  • Form factor: Flex-ATX suitable for compact server chassis
  • Memory: 4 x DDR4 DIMM slots, maximum supported memory up to 512 GB
  • Storage interfaces: multiple SATA III ports with RAID 0/1/5/10 support
  • Graphics and management: Aspeed AST2500 BMC with remote management and video output
  • Networking: Gigabit Ethernet connectivity for network and management traffic
  • BIOS: UEFI firmware

How to use

Install the motherboard into a compatible Flex-ATX or larger chassis and connect the required power supply following the chassis and Supermicro installation guides. Populate DDR4 DIMMs in matched pairs or according to the memory population rules in the motherboard manual to achieve the desired capacity and optimal performance. Attach SATA III drives and configure RAID arrays through the on-board RAID controller or UEFI setup utility. Connect network cables to the Gigabit Ethernet ports and configure IP addresses and management access as required. Use the Aspeed AST2500 BMC for out-of-band management, remote console access and firmware updates.

Usage recommendations

For stable operation and longevity, use ECC DDR4 DIMMs if system memory error correction is required, follow the motherboard memory population guidelines to balance channels, and ensure adequate airflow in the chassis to cool the SoC and VRM components under sustained load.
